family planning, 
    1. the concept or a program of limiting the size of families through the spacing or prevention of pregnancies, esp. for economic reasons.
    2. (loosely) birth control.
    • 1935–40

family planning n
  1. the control of the number of children in a family and of the intervals between them, esp by the use of contraceptives
